Sembcorp to more than double stake in Senoko Energy

Sembcorp Industries is proposing an acquisition in Senoko Energy that could potentially more than double its interest in the local utility company.Its wholly owned subsidiary, Sembcorp Utilities, has signed a sale and purchase agreement to increase its interest in Senoko to a maximum 70%, more than...
